What do cats need to prepare for giving birth?

Preparation for cats to give birth:
1. Provide an elegant, quiet and comfortable delivery environment for the female cat. Find a warm and quiet place for the cat, prepare a large enough birthing box or nest, and lay out a soft and large enough mat so that the mother cat can rest and live with her many kittens after giving birth.
2. Also prepare towels, scissors, disinfectant, warm water and other auxiliary tools. Normally, healthy cats can cope with birthing problems on their own. However, don’t be afraid of ten thousand, just be afraid of the unexpected. If the female cat is in danger during childbirth, as a parent, you can also provide timely help. For example, cutting the cat's umbilical cord or something.
3. You also need to prepare the contact information of the veterinarian. This is very important, just in case, and you can call your veterinarian when your cat shows signs of labor. With the help and guidance of the veterinarian at the cat delivery site, I believe the female cat will be able to give birth smoothly.
4. As a parent, you also need to prepare some sugar water or chicken soup for cats to drink. During the birth process, the cat can be given some to drink to replenish some energy in time, so that the female cat can continue to give birth and ensure the safety and smoothness of the birth.
Things to note when cats are pregnant:
1. Pay attention to calcium supplements. Pregnant cats have a very high demand for calcium.
2. Create a good environment to ensure the cat’s sleep quality.
3. Do not exercise strenuously. Excessive exercise can cause cats to miscarry easily.
4. Don’t hug the cat casually to prevent hurting the baby cat in the belly.
5. Pay attention to your diet and choose foods with high nutritional value.
